Job summary

Adecco's client - A leading international company in plastic products manufacturing in Tay Ninh is seeking a highly skilled and motivated Quality Manager to join their team.  The ideal candidate will ensure all products meet or exceed industry standards, customer expectations, and regulatory requirements while fostering a culture of continuous improvement.

Job Responsibilities

  • Quality Strategy: Develop and implement a comprehensive quality management system (QMS) to maintain and improve product quality standards.
  • Leadership: Manage and mentor the quality team to ensure consistent application of quality control procedures and standards across all production processes.
  • Compliance: Ensure compliance with industry regulations, certifications, and company policies related to quality and safety.
  • Audits and Inspections: Plan and oversee internal and external audits, ensuring readiness and compliance with regulatory and customer audits.
  • Issue Resolution: Investigate quality issues, identify root causes, and implement corrective and preventive actions to minimize recurrence.
  • Testing and Inspection: Supervise the testing of raw materials, in-process components, and finished products to ensure adherence to quality standards.
  • Supplier Quality Management: Work closely with suppliers to monitor and improve the quality of incoming materials and components.
  • Reporting: Prepare and present quality performance reports, highlighting key metrics, trends, and improvement initiatives.
  • Continuous Improvement: Lead initiatives to enhance quality processes and standards, incorporating lean manufacturing and Six Sigma principles.
